One of the most acclaimed music documentaries of all time, Say Amen, Somebody is George T. Nierenberg’s masterpiece – a joyous, funny, deeply emotional celebration of African American culture, featuring the father of Gospel, Thomas A. Dorsey (“”Precious Lord, Take My Hand””); Mother Willie Mae Ford Smith; and soul-shaking performances by the Barrett Sisters, the O’Neal Twins, and Zella Jackson Price.
When it was first released in 1982, the film garnered rave reviews around the world. Unseen for decades, Say Amen, Somebody was restored to 4K by Milestone in collaboration with the director. The restoration was produced by the National Museum of African American History and Culture with funding by The Robert Frederick Smith Fund for the Digitization and Curation of African American History and the Academy Film Archive. The new restoration features restored Dolby stereo and 5.1 soundtracks.
